1. A method performed in a communication system for determining room occupancy of a room in a facility having an indoor positioning system with wireless access point (AP) fingerprints each correlated to a location in the facility, the method comprising:

  • receiving, at the communication system, a request from a computing device for a room occupancy assessment associated with the room;

    obtaining location data, from the indoor positioning system, that correlates to the location of wireless devices associated with each of one or more people within the facility;

    obtaining data correlated to room occupancy from at least one of the network connected devices selected from a room check-in scanner, an in-room data port, an in-room charging port, or an in-room telephone, the data being position-inference user data for the wireless devices associated with each of the one or more people;

    determining, based on the location data and the position-inference user data, whether the room is occupied; and

    sending the determination of whether the room is occupied to the computing device.
